Determining Liability

The liability for accidents which involve large trucks can be more complicated than when two cars collide. This is due to the fact that there are many parties who can be held responsible for the collision, including the trucking company, the driver, and the manufacturer of the vehicle. Your lawyer will collaborate with you to determine which parties should be identified in your case as defendants and ensure that all responsible people are held accountable.

Because trucking cases usually involve more serious injuries, they also require longer to settle than car accident claims. The plaintiff's lawyer must pay for court fees as well as travel, expert witnesses, depositions and other expenses connected to the case. They will also need to wait until the end of the case before receiving payment for their services.

Additionally, because truck accidents tend to be more severe than regular traffic accidents and therefore, settlements of these cases are generally higher, too. This is because the damages a victim claims from the plaintiff are more substantial, which may include medical treatment for lifetime injuries, loss in future earnings potential property damage, and other economic losses. The severity of the injuries can be a major psychological impact on the victim, that may require additional rehabilitation and therapy.

Going to Court

Due to the difference in size between a semi truck, and a passenger car of average size, 18 wheeler accidents can cause serious injuries and devastating damage. These injuries can vary from whiplash to brain trauma, spinal cord injury, or even amputations. In most cases these injuries require extensive medical attention and long-term rehabilitation.

Most truck accidents are resolved in court without the settlement. This will include any damages incurred by the victim, including past and future medical costs loss of income, property damage. However, there are some cases that are not resolved through negotiation and need to go to trial. It is important for victims to have a skilled lawyer to help them ensure they get a fair settlement.

The right New York 18-wheeler accident lawyer can make a huge difference in the time it takes to receive an equitable and complete settlement. They'll be able collect evidence quickly, such as photographs of the accident scene and eyewitness statements, and medical records. They can also analyze the evidence and determine who is accountable for the accident.

The majority of plaintiff lawyers are paid on a contingency fee that means they won't be paid until their client succeeds in winning their case or agrees to an agreement.
